Nomura Holdings Inc ADR (NYSE:NMR – Get Free Report) has received a consensus recommendation of “Buy” from the five ratings firms that are presently covering the company, MarketBeat reports. One investment analyst has rated the stock with a hold rating, three have assigned a buy rating and one has assigned a strong buy rating to the company. The average 1-year price objective among brokerages that have covered the stock in the last year is $10.20.
Several research firms have recently weighed in on NMR. Bank of America raised shares of Nomura from a “neutral” rating to a “buy” rating and set a $10.20 price target on the stock in a research note on Thursday, June 25th. Wall Street Zen upgraded shares of Nomura from a “hold” rating to a “buy” rating in a report on Saturday, August 1st. Weiss Ratings raised shares of Nomura from a “hold (c)” rating to a “hold (c+)” rating in a research note on Friday, July 17th. Nomura upgraded Nomura to a “buy” rating and set a $10.20 target price on the stock in a report on Thursday, June 25th. Finally, Zacks Research upgraded Nomura from a “hold” rating to a “strong-buy” rating in a research report on Wednesday, July 29th.

Nomura Stock Up 1.9%
Nomura (NYSE:NMR – Get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ings data on Tuesday, June 30th. The financial services provider reported $0.30 earnings per share for the quarter. Nomura had a return on equity of 10.42% and a net margin of 8.09%.The company had revenue of $4.19 billion for the quarter. Equities research analysts forecast that Nomura will post 0.93 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

About Nomura
Nomura Holdings, Inc is a global financial services group headquartered in Tokyo, Japan, with origins dating back to 1925 when Tokushichi Nomura II established the firm as a securities business. Over the decades Nomura has grown from a domestic securities house into a multinational financial services firm by expanding its product offerings and international footprint. The company is publicly listed and operates through a network of subsidiaries and branches to serve a broad client base.
Nomura’s principal businesses encompass retail brokerage, wholesale (investment banking and global markets), and asset management.
